The Ordinary World contained a lot of life philosophy. These included: People could be ordinary, but they could not be mediocre. A person's greatness could be shown in the most ordinary things. Everyone had their own destiny, and only they could decide their own destiny. Even an ordinary person had their own life. They could live a wonderful life and write their own life. A person's vitality was strengthened in the suffering of pain. Pain, regret, and imperfection were the norm of life. Cherish the ordinary, bravely pursue your dreams, be grateful and give, persist in your self-worth, and savor the beauty of life. These philosophical principles were deeply rooted in the hearts of the people through the characters and plots in the novel, becoming eternal classics in people's hearts.

Definitely. A philosophy graphic novel can be just as profound. The combination of pictures and words can create a unique impact. The art can evoke emotions that enhance the understanding of the philosophical concepts. Take 'Maus' for instance. It's a graphic novel that deals with heavy topics like the Holocaust and the nature of humanity, which are very profound philosophical areas.
